智慧校园系统与机器人技术的融合应用
2025-07-13 18:39
随着人工智能和物联网技术的发展,智慧校园系统正逐步融入更多智能化设备。其中,机器人作为智能终端的重要组成部分,在校园管理、教学辅助和学生服务等方面展现出巨大潜力。
在智慧校园中,机器人可以承担导览、信息查询、安全巡逻等任务。例如,通过搭载摄像头、语音识别模块和移动平台,机器人能够与师生进行交互,并提供实时信息支持。
下面是一个简单的Python代码示例,展示了如何使用ROS(Robot Operating System)控制一个基本的校园服务机器人:
import rospy from geometry_msgs.msg import Twist def move_robot(): rospy.init_node('robot_mover', anonymous=True) pub = rospy.Publisher('/cmd_vel', Twist, queue_size=10) rate = rospy.Rate(10) # 10Hz while not rospy.is_shutdown(): move_cmd = Twist() move_cmd.linear.x = 0.5 # 前进速度 move_cmd.angular.z = 0.0 # 不旋转 pub.publish(move_cmd) rate.sleep() if __name__ == '__main__': try: move_robot() except rospy.ROSInterruptException: pass
上述代码通过ROS发布消息到`/cmd_vel`话题,控制机器人的运动。在实际应用中,还需要集成SLAM、路径规划、人脸识别等高级功能,以提升机器人在校园环境中的自主性和智能化水平。
综上所述,智慧校园系统与机器人技术的结合,为教育信息化提供了新的发展方向,未来将有更广泛的应用前景。
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:智慧校园